简要总结

Lid cleansing is the standard regime that is recommended for the management of blepharitis in the UK and beyond. Whilst many successful commercial preparations exist, and some with clinical evidence, professional guidelines (UK Royal College of Ophthalmologists, UK College of Optometrists, AAO, etc.) continue to advocate the use of a diluted solution of baby shampoo, despite no clinical evidence of its safety, tolerance or long term effectiveness, and despite a statement form the manufacturers that it should not be used for this purpose. Where licensed, registered products exist it seems bizarre that we have this situation, but a Cochrane review from 2012 indicated that only a longitudinal, randomized controlled trial against baby shampoo would alter their conclusions. Whilst that sort of clinical study is possible, it is proposed here to start with a short-term study to look at the immediate changes induced in the tear film and ocular surface when comparing baby shampoo with Blephasol solution, in a blind, randomized controlled trial.

详细描述

Aims/Key Questions: The hypothesis is: Diluted baby shampoo is more disruptive and deleterious to the human tear film and ocular surface than Blephaclean solution. It is expected that there will be a clinically meaningful difference (approximately 30%) in the non-invasive tear-break up time after the application of baby shampoo compared to Blephaclean.

Potential outcomes: To raise awareness that the safety profile of baby shampoo is insufficient to make it a professional and ethical recommendation for daily lid hygiene.

Recruitment: All subjects will be recruited from the staff and student population of the Faculty of Health and Human Sciences, Plymouth University as well as patients of The Centre for Eyecare Excellence (CEE) and Well-being centre (WBC) at Plymouth University. The recruitment will be carried out via email, flyers and direct invitation. After the first contact, the information sheet, as well as the informed contents, will be sent, or a printed version will be given to all potential subjects.

Design: This prospective study is a two-visit, prospective, cross-sectional, double-blinded and randomized controlled trial. The basic population is described as a healthy UK population with diverse ethnic backgrounds and physiological variation. The principal investigator will carry out the data collection at the Peninsula Allied Health Centre, CEE or WBC (Plymouth University). Ethical approval was grantet. This study conforms to the ethical principles of the Declaration of Helsinki, ICH guidelines for Good Clinical Practice (GCP) and Plymouth University's Principles for Research Involving Human Participants.

Sample size calculations were performed for detecting differences between two dependent not-normally distributed means. A maximum effect size (NIK-BUT difference after the application of baby shampoo compared to Blephaclean) of 0.4 is expected with alpha=0.05 and beta=0.20 (80% power). A sample size of 52 will be required. If considering potential dropouts, the study will aim to recruit 60 subjects. The effect size was calculated based on the distribution of the NIK-BUT in healthy eyes (Abdelfattah et al. 2015).

入选标准

  • Subjects must be over 18 and under 60 years of age
  • Completed a comprehensive eye exam in the last two years
  • Contact lens wearers must have stopped wearing for a minimum of two days if wearing soft contact lenses and one week if wearing RGP lenses.
  • The subject must have an adequate understanding of the English language to be able to comprehend the oral and written instructions.

排除标准

  • Determination during enrolment:
  • Pregnancy or breast-feeding whilst the examination
  • Application of any eye drops within the last 48 hours before the examination
  • Application of medication within the last 30 days which influences the body water regulation system (e.g. antidepressants, diuretics, corticosteroids, histamine-receptor antagonist, immune-modulators)
  • Change of ocular therapy within the last 30 days before the examination
  • Permanent application of eye drops or ocular medication
  • On-going ocular treatment
  • Any kind of ocular pathology or history of refractive surgery
  • Any kind of systemic disease which affect collagen and the body water regulation system (Marfan syndrome, osteogenesis imperfect, pseudoxanthoma elasticum, Ehlers-Danlos, diabetes, rosacea, acne, cardiovascular disease, thyroid disease)
